Ordinals
beta
Sat 1257377614967552
decimal
292951.114967552
degree
0°82951′631″114967552‴
percentile
59.87512458812705%
name
eydzpssdjdp
cycle
0
epoch
1
period
145
block
292951
offset
114967552
timestamp
2014-03-28 19:14:06 UTC
rarity
common
prev
next